What Types of Work and Facilities Can Telemetry Registered Nurses Expect in Fort Smith, AR?

As a Registered Nurse specializing in telemetry, you will have the opportunity to work in a variety of healthcare settings in Fort Smith, Arkansas, including acute care hospitals, rehabilitation centers, and specialized cardiac units. In these facilities, you will monitor patients with cardiovascular issues, assess vital signs, and interpret telemetry data to provide critical care for those in unstable conditions. Your role will involve collaborating with a multidisciplinary team to develop and implement individualized care plans, educate patients and their families about heart health, and support recovery in a fast-paced environment. What types of experience are required or preferred for a Tele Travel job in Fort Smith?

Telemetry Registered Nurses typically need experience in cardiac monitoring and managing patients with heart conditions, along with a current RN license and BLS/ACLS certifications. Additionally, prior travel nursing experience is often preferred to ensure adaptability in various clinical settings.
